Backend Tech Lead, AI Apps

workהגשת מועמדות
  • pin_dropמיקוםתל אביב יפו
  • bubble_chartקטגוריה--- Please Select ---
  • schoolנסיון5+ שנות ניסיון
  • workסוג משרהמשרה מלאה

תיאור משרה

Your Impact:

You will have a technical lead role, that has a great impact on how we build, scale, and maintain AI applications that are used by hundreds of thousands of users on a monthly basis. You will drive and impact architecture, designs, execution, serve as a role model and provide mentorship to group members, and support them in their professional growth.

Who You’ll Work With:

You’ll be part of Einstein. Our goal in Einstein is to build easy to use turnkey B2B AI applications, that simplify business processes, help to make business decisions, and create measurable value for the customer (some of the existing examples are Einstein Opportunity Scoring, Einstein Forecasting, and Einstein Campaign Attribution). Our AI solutions prioritize the best next steps, help to win more opportunities, help to make better decisions, increase forecast accuracy, and more. We partner with multiple clouds at Salesforce, including Sales, Service, Revenue, Marketing, and Industries. We serve thousands of Salesforce customers, including some of the largest ones. Our products deliver 80+ Billion predictions a day.

Einstein is a global organization, with large groups both in Israel and the US. It is made up of data scientists, data, platform and DevOps engineers, and growth analysts who are dedicated to driving product strategy with data-driven insights. The team works with executives, product managers, designers, developers, user researchers, marketers, and sales strategy team members across all Cloud businesses to discover new opportunities for growth and optimization, experiment with data, drive adoption, and provide actionable insights that impact product strategy.


  • Build, scale and maintain AI applications that are used by hundreds of thousands of users on a monthly basis
  • Understand the customer/business requirements and translate them into elegant/flexible/easy-to-use capabilities
  • Lead/Participate in Software Design and Architecture discussions of complex large scale systems
  • Drive the execution and delivery of features by collaborating with architects, product owners, engineers, user experience designers, and data scientists
  • Develop test strategies, design automation frameworks, write unit/functional tests to drive up code coverage and automation goals
  • Lead and mentor junior members of the group
  • Take on hands-on complex code challenges and be a 10x multiplier
  • Adopt, embrace, and promote agile and test-driven software development practices
  • Make/Participate in critical decisions that attribute to the success of the applications and the underlying platform
  • Be a multiplier and have a passion for the team and team members’ success
  • Be a vocal advocate for technical excellence and help the team members make sound decisions

דרישות תפקיד

Required Qualifications:

  • 10+ years of hands-on experience building, scaling, and maintaining large scale, complex distributed systems in the SaaS space that scale for millions of users
  • In-depth working knowledge of at least one object-oriented language (Python, Java, C#). Our stack is mostly Python-based, with some services built-in Java
  • Solid experience in developing/maintaining using public cloud technologies such as AWS, Azure, GCP, or Heroku
  • Experience in creating system architecture designs and providing review/feedback on designs
  • Strong verbal and written communication skills. Self-driven with superior organizational and project management skills. Ability to work effectively in a distributed team setting and across time zones
  • Ability to support/resolve production customer escalations with excellent debugging and problem-solving skills
  • Experience with Agile development methodologies, continuous integration (CI), and continuous deployment (CD)
  • Experience in test-driven development with a focus on unit testing, integration testing, and end-to-end automation
  • Experience with Data model design and familiarity with SQL and NoSQL

Preferred Qualifications:

  • Experience in cross-geography work with US-based teams
  • Familiarity with service ownership in production, and available for on-call support on a regular rotation basis
  • Ability to cross-over to help on the Platform and DevOps side of things (CI/CD tools, Terraform, Automation, etc.)
  • Exposure to Artificial Intelligence (AI) technologies such as Machine Learning, Deep Learning, etc. from a data engineering perspective, and experience working with data scientists in taking models to production
  • Experience using Analytics and Monitoring tools such as DataDog, Pingdom, New Relic, Graphite, Sumo Logic, and Splunk
  • Some Salesforce platform/ecosystem/implementation knowledge (either as a developer or as admin)
  • Bachelors degree in Computer Science, Software Engineering, or related STEM field (or equivalent work experience) with strong competencies in algorithms, data structures, and software design

workהגשת מועמדות


על החברה

סיילספורס היא ענקית פתרונות הענן וה-CRM המובילה בעולם, מחברת בין חברות מכל הגדלים והתעשיות ללקוחותיהן. סיילספורס מאפשרת להן לנצל את הכוח הטמון בטכנולוגיה - ענן, סושיאל מדיה, בלוקצ׳יין, בינה מלאכותית. מרכז הפיתוח של החברה בישראל ממשיך לגדול, בעיקר באזורי Big Data ו-AI. עובדי החברה בישראל הם בעלי תרומה משמעותית לחידושים הטכנולוגיים בתחומים אלה שמשפיעים על מיליוני משתמשים בכל העולם.

account_balanceעוד על Salesforce